Abstract

The outer factorization is the key operation in spectral factorization and in the determination of filters with minimal phase and given amplitude response. This paper investigates the continuity behavior of the outer factorization mapping and it gives a characterization of all outer functions which belong to the same smoothness class as the corresponding data. In general, the outer factorization yields a certain loss in smoothness, which has an impact on the approximation behavior of the spectral factors and desired filters, respectively.
